This worksheet provides a structured approach to solving ratio problems where the difference between quantities is known.
In Section A learners will compare two questions: one where the ratio is given and a total, in the other a ratio is given and the difference between the quantities is known. Learners will consider how the two different problems can be solved.
In Section B, pupils will answer a set of 8 minimally different questions. The problems require students to calculate not just one missing quantity but also the total number of individuals based on a given ratio.
Section C takes the application further by introducing more complex scenarios, including medal counts in the Olympics and inheritance divisions, requiring students to work with multi-part ratios and differences.
